About this program

The Bachelor's Degree in Educational Studies at Wingate University provides a comprehensive exploration of the field of education, focusing on theory, practice, and policy. Throughout the program, students engage with various educational philosophies, learning theories, and instructional methodologies that prepare them for a dynamic career in educational settings. The curriculum is designed to foster critical thinking, reflective practice, and a deep understanding of the socio-cultural influences on education.

Structured around core courses, elective subjects, and experiential learning opportunities, the program allows students to tailor their education according to their interests and career aspirations. Core courses typically cover areas such as child development, curriculum design, assessment strategies, and educational psychology, while electives might include specialized topics like special education, technology in education, or international education.

Students gain essential skills in communication, collaboration, and classroom management, as well as cultural competence and advocacy for educational equity. This makes the program ideal for those who aim to inspire and empower learners in a variety of contexts, from traditional K-12 settings to non-traditional educational environments.

Studying in the United States offers unique perspectives on educational reforms and diverse teaching practices, enriching students' understanding of global education issues. Wingate University, with its commitment to nurturing future educators, provides an environment that fosters growth, innovation, and practical experience.

Entry requirements

To be considered for admission to the Bachelor's Degree in Educational Studies, students typically need a high school diploma or equivalent with a strong academic record. Additionally, motivation and passion for education are highly valued, as evidenced by personal statements or letters of recommendation.
English: Students whose first language is not English are generally expected to demonstrate proficiency through standardized tests such as IELTS or TOEFL. An IELTS score of 6.5 or a TOEFL score of 79 is often the minimum requirement for admission.
International students: International students need to secure a student visa to study in the United States. Important documents include a valid passport, acceptance letter from Wingate University, and proof of financial support. It is essential to check the official immigration website for detailed requirements specific to international students.
